2024年4月22日发(作者:)
数据库备份和恢复是每个数据库管理人员都必须面对的重要任务。
在备份和恢复策略中,备份压缩和性能优化是不可或缺的关键因素。
本文将探讨数据库备份与恢复策略中备份压缩和性能优化的重要性以
及相关技术和方法。
一、备份压缩的重要性
数据库备份是数据库管理中至关重要的一环。通过备份,可以确
保数据的安全性和完整性,以应对意外情况,如硬件故障、人为错误
或自然灾害等。然而,备份数据占用大量的磁盘空间是备份过程中的
一个常见问题。因此,备份压缩成为了减少存储空间占用、提高备份
效率的一种解决方案。
数据库备份压缩可以降低备份文件的体积,从而减少磁盘空间的
占用量。这不仅有助于降低备份存储成本,还可以提高备份速度和效
率。备份压缩还可以减少网络传输时间,并可以在恢复过程中减少磁
盘I/O的负载。
二、备份压缩的技术和方法
备份压缩有多种技术和方法可供选择。其中一种常见的方法是使
用压缩工具对备份文件进行压缩。压缩工具可以将备份文件转换为较
小的存储文件,从而减少磁盘空间的占用量。常见的压缩工具有gzip、
zip和rar等。使用这些工具,可以调整压缩比例以平衡存储占用和备
份恢复速度之间的关系。
另一种备份压缩的方法是利用数据库管理系统中的压缩功能。许
多主流数据库管理系统,如Oracle、SQL Server和MySQL等,提供了
内置的备份压缩功能。通过设置合适的参数和选项,可以在备份过程
中自动压缩备份文件。这种方法通常比使用外部压缩工具更方便,因
为它不需要额外的操作或工具。
三、性能优化的重要性
性能优化是数据库备份与恢复过程中不可忽视的因素。备份和恢
复操作通常需要消耗大量的系统资源,如CPU、内存和磁盘等。如果备
份和恢复过程过于耗费资源,可能会导致系统性能下降,甚至影响到
正常的数据库操作。
为了优化备份和恢复性能,可以采取以下措施。首先,可以在非
高峰期执行备份和恢复操作,以避免对正常业务造成影响。其次,可
以调整备份和恢复的参数和选项,以提高操作的效率。例如,可以优
化磁盘I/O操作,减少数据传输时间。此外,还可以通过增加硬件资
源,如CPU和内存,来提高备份和恢复的并发性能。
四、性能优化的技术和方法
性能优化的技术和方法有很多。首先,可以通过合理的数据库设
计和规划来优化备份和恢复性能。合理的数据库结构可以减少数据冗
余和碎片化,从而提高备份和恢复的效率。其次,可以使用快照技术。
快照可以在不中断正常数据库操作的情况下,创建备份副本,从而提
高备份过程的效率和可靠性。
此外,还可以采用增量备份和差异备份的策略。增量备份只备份
上次完全备份后的增量数据,而差异备份仅备份自上次备份以来的更
改数据。这种备份策略可以减少备份时间和磁盘空间的占用,从而提
高备份效率。
总结
数据库备份与恢复策略中备份压缩和性能优化是重要的环节。备
份压缩可以减少磁盘空间的占用,从而降低存储成本,并提高备份效
率。性能优化可以减少资源消耗,提高备份和恢复的效率和可靠性。
通过合适的技术和方法,可以优化备份和恢复过程,提高数据库的可
靠性和可用性。
发布者:admin,转转请注明出处:http://www.yc00.com/news/1713759312a2312856.html
评论列表(0条)